OnLive announced this morning that they have teamed up with Vizio to bring its cloud-based game service to the consumer electronics manufacture in a deal that includes HDTVs, Blu-ray players, Android tablets and smartphones.
The OnLive service will be integrated with Vizio's VIA Plus line of HDTVs in resolutions up to 1080p and can support 3D as well. Vizio is also launching a new line of Blu-ray players, Android tables and smartphones that will support the gaming service as well.
"With the click of a remote control, or a tap on a tablet or phone touchscreen, VIZIO owners will be immediately transported into the OnLive Game Service, with the same state-of-the-art, instant game experience you get with the OnLive MicroConsole TV adapter, PCs, Macs, and the iPad," CEO Stever Perlman states at the OnLive blog. "In fact, you’ll be able to save your OnLive game on one device, and instantly resume it on another device. Seamlessly."
OnLive will be present at CES 2011 which kicks off tomorrow to show off the integration partnership with Vizio as well as show off some other new features such as SRS 5.1 Surround Sound for games.
